FAQs
What is the hourly rate for the Lab Programs Intern position?
The hourly rate for this position is $17.00/hour.
What is the work schedule for the Lab Programs Intern?
The work schedule consists of a rotating format; Week One includes 3 weekdays from 3:30pm to 8:00pm (13.5 hours) and Week Two includes 2 weekdays from 3:30pm to 8:00pm and Saturday from 2:30pm to 11:00pm (17 hours).
What qualifications are required for this position?
Candidates must be enrolled in an OSF Medical Laboratory Science or Histotechnology program, with specific GPA and course credit requirements detailed in the job description.
Is prior experience in phlebotomy preferred for this role?
Yes, a minimum of 3 months previous experience as a phlebotomist is preferred.
Is this position available to students?
Yes, this position is specifically for students enrolled in OSF Laboratory Clinical Laboratory Science or Histotechnology programs.
What kind of laboratory procedures will I be performing as an intern?
As an intern, you may perform various laboratory procedures including phlebotomy, specimen labeling, assessing specimen quality, and conducting manual and automated test analysis.

What is the minimum cumulative GPA required for Medical Laboratory Science program students?
A minimum cumulative GPA of 2.75 is required for students enrolled in the Medical Laboratory Science program.
What is the minimum cumulative GPA required for Histotechnology program students?
A minimum cumulative GPA of 2.50 is required for students enrolled in the Histotechnology program.
